Priority: High. Since the Tuesday rollout, the VRAMscope profiler on the Kestrelwood cluster intermittently reports negative free GPU memory when two Lorica inference pods share a device. We suspect the allocator hook double-counts freed arenas during concurrent teardown. Repro rate is roughly 1 in 6 runs of the soak suite. Please capture a full allocator snapshot before restarting any pod, as restarts clear the evidence. The regression first appeared in the following build.

trace token, kawig-yaweg: htk14_a588ad9a550da9

## Deploying the Gatewick Proctor Queue

Deploys are pretty painless: push to main, wait for the pipeline, then watch the queue drain dashboard for five minutes. If candidates pile up mid-exam, roll back first and ask questions later — the queue replays safely. Everything the workers care about lives in one config block, shown here for reference.

settings of bafof-yagef:
JOROX_PIN=8740
JOROX_TENANT=pelox
JOROX_METRICS_HOST=metrics.jorox.qorvelworks.internal
JOROX_SEAL=seal_c78f63c1
JOROX_STANDBY_TEAM=norax

**Vendor note: Inkmill markdown pipeline**

Rendering for Parchway docs is outsourced to Inkmill under an annual contract, renewing each March. They handle sanitization and PDF export; we own the upload queue. SLA: 4-hour response on rendering failures. Escalate only after two failed retries. Their support desk is reachable at the address below.

billing contact of hahaf-baguf = zorael.tammir.jorius@sivrelhq.internal

Minutes — Management Meeting, Brynmore Media Group

Attendees: regional leads and branch managers. The committee reviewed the proposed Opal tier, a mid-price subscription adding offline access and family sharing. Pricing was agreed at launch minus introductory discount; rollout begins in the Westholt branches first. Support scripts and billing changes are due within three weeks. Managers should brief staff carefully, noting the confidential plan appended below.

confidential, kagup-bafog: Fraaxax Group is in early talks to buy Soroxox Group for about $343.8 million. The Olidor launch date is June 14, and nothing goes to the press before then. Legal wants the Aldmirek Logistics term sheet signed before July 23.